Can Adient Maintain its Dominance in the Automotive Seating Market?
Adient, a titan in the automotive industry, has navigated a dynamic landscape since its 2016 spin-off, establishing itself as a global leader in automotive seating. Its journey, marked by strategic focus and operational optimization, showcases the critical importance of a well-defined growth strategy. With a vast global footprint and a significant market share, Adient's story is a compelling case study in strategic expansion and innovation.

How Does Adient Invest in Innovation?
The company's growth strategy is significantly driven by its dedication to innovation and technological advancements. This is particularly evident in areas like smart seating, lightweighting, and sustainable materials. The company consistently invests in research and development (R&D) to enhance its product offerings and manufacturing processes, aiming to stay ahead in the competitive automotive seating market.
Focusing on the future, the company is developing smart seating solutions that incorporate sensors and electronics. These features provide personalized comfort, health monitoring, and enhanced safety. The company's commitment to sustainability is also a key strategic focus, with an emphasis on incorporating recycled and bio-based materials, which is becoming increasingly important in the automotive industry.
The company's approach to digital transformation involves leveraging data analytics and automation to optimize design, production, and supply chain management, driving efficiency and reducing costs. This strategic direction is crucial for maintaining a competitive edge and adapting to the evolving needs of the automotive industry. The company is actively developing smart seating solutions. These integrate sensors and electronics to provide personalized comfort, health monitoring, and enhanced safety features. This aligns with the broader trend of connected cars, enhancing the driving experience.
Lightweighting is crucial for improving fuel efficiency in internal combustion engine vehicles and extending range in EVs. The company is pioneering the use of advanced materials and design methodologies. This includes exploring composites and innovative metal alloys to reduce seat weight without compromising safety or comfort.
The company is making significant strides in sustainability. It focuses on incorporating recycled and bio-based materials into its seating components. It also optimizes its manufacturing processes to reduce waste and energy consumption. This commitment is a strategic differentiator.

What Is Adient’s Growth Forecast?
The financial outlook for Adient, a key player in the automotive seating market, is shaped by its strategic focus on operational efficiency and disciplined capital allocation. The company's future prospects are closely tied to its ability to navigate the evolving automotive industry. Recent financial reports and analyst forecasts provide insights into its trajectory, highlighting key areas of focus for sustainable growth.
Adient's Adient growth strategy is centered on enhancing profitability through cost optimization and improved manufacturing efficiency. This approach aims to generate robust free cash flow, which can be reinvested into growth initiatives, debt reduction, or returned to shareholders. The company's financial performance is indicative of its commitment to long-term value creation and market leadership in the automotive seating market.
In its fiscal first quarter 2025 earnings report, Adient reported net sales of $3.9 billion, demonstrating strong operational performance. The company's financial strategy includes optimizing its cost structure and improving manufacturing efficiency to enhance profitability. The company's long-term financial goals are aligned with sustaining its market leadership, expanding into new product segments, and capitalizing on the automotive industry's transition to electric vehicles. The automotive seating market is highly competitive, with many global and regional players. This competition can pressure pricing and reduce profit margins, affecting the company's financial performance. The company must continually innovate and improve its offerings to stay ahead.
Changes in vehicle safety, emissions, and environmental standards require significant R&D investments. These regulatory shifts can impact profitability and demand adjustments in manufacturing processes. The company must adapt quickly to remain compliant.
Supply chain disruptions, such as semiconductor shortages and geopolitical issues, threaten production schedules and costs. The company mitigates this by diversifying its supplier base and strengthening its supply chain resilience. This proactive approach is crucial.
New entrants and rapid advancements in alternative mobility solutions can challenge traditional seating designs. The company addresses this by investing heavily in innovation, focusing on smart seating and lightweighting technologies. Staying at the forefront is key.
Availability of skilled labor and capital for investments can impede growth. The company manages these risks through strategic workforce planning and disciplined financial management. Scenario planning helps assess market condition impacts.
Fluctuations in raw material costs, such as steel and plastics, can significantly affect profitability. The company employs hedging strategies and seeks to optimize procurement to mitigate these risks. Effective cost management is essential.
